Karachi to Dubai Flight Details

The distance between Karachi and Dubai is about 1,188.33 km. The average flying time from Karachi to Dubai is around 2 hours 25 minutes. Based on Trip.com's latest data, travel demand is highest in July. The off-season for travel is October.

Major Airports in Dubai and Transportation

Dubai International Airport. Source: Photo by Zeena Saifii/CNN Travel

Dubai International Airport. Source: Photo by Zeena Saifii/CNN Travel

Dubai is a major travel hub, offering several airports to cater to the growing number of visitors. Each airport provides a range of services and facilities to ensure a comfortable travel experience. Here are the major airports in Dubai:

  • Dubai International Airport: Located in the heart of Dubai, Al Garhoud, Dubai International Airport is the primary international airport serving Dubai. It is one of the busiest airports globally and consists of three terminals: Terminal 1, Terminal 2, and Terminal 3. Terminal 3 is the largest and is primarily used by Emirates Airlines. The airport offers a wide range of amenities, including lounges, shopping, dining, and various services to enhance the travel experience of passengers. Shuttle services are available, free of charge, and operate at regular intervals to transport passengers between terminals.
  • Al Maktoum International Airport: Located in Jebel Ali, Dubai. This airport is also known as the Dubai World Central, and it serves as both a cargo and passenger airport. It is part of the larger Dubai South development and is designed to complement Dubai International Airport. Al Maktoum International has a dedicated passenger terminal and facilitates cargo operations with state-of-the-art infrastructure.

Tips to Travel to Dubai

Dubai Gold Souk

Dubai Gold Souk

If you are a first-time visitor to Dubai, here are some tips to make your trip memorable:

  • Check visa requirements: Before traveling to Dubai, make sure to check the visa requirements for your country. Ensure that you have all the necessary documents to enter the city.
  • Dress modestly: Dubai is a conservative city, so it's important to dress modestly, especially when visiting religious sites or public places. Respect the local customs and traditions.
  • Stay hydrated: Dubai has a hot and arid climate, so it's essential to stay hydrated. Carry a water bottle with you and drink plenty of fluids throughout the day.
  • Respect local laws: Familiarize yourself with the local laws and regulations in Dubai. Avoid any activities that may be considered offensive or illegal.
  • Explore the local cuisine: Dubai offers a diverse range of culinary delights. Don't miss the opportunity to try traditional Emirati dishes and explore the local food scene.
  • Be mindful of cultural norms: Dubai is a multicultural city with people from different backgrounds. Be respectful of cultural norms and traditions to ensure a harmonious experience.

By following these tips, you can have a memorable and enjoyable trip to Dubai.

Explore Dubai

Palm Jumeirah, Dubai.

Palm Jumeirah, Dubai.

Dubai is a city that offers a plethora of attractions and experiences. Here are 10 popular attractions in Dubai that you must visit:

  1. Burj Khalifa: Experience breathtaking views from the world's tallest building.
  2. Palm Jumeirah: Explore the iconic man-made island with luxurious resorts and stunning beaches.
  3. Dubai Mall: Shop till you drop at one of the largest malls in the world, offering a wide range of brands and entertainment options.
  4. Desert Safari: Embark on an exhilarating desert adventure with dune bashing, camel rides, and traditional entertainment.
  5. Dubai Marina: Enjoy a leisurely stroll along the picturesque waterfront, lined with restaurants, cafes, and luxury yachts.
  6. Gold Souk: Indulge in a shopping spree at the famous Gold Souk, known for its dazzling display of gold jewelry.
  7. Burj Al Arab: Admire the iconic sail-shaped hotel, known for its luxurious amenities and world-class service.
  8. Dubai Creek: Take a traditional abra ride along the historic Dubai Creek and explore the city's heritage.
  9. Madinat Jumeirah: Immerse yourself in Arabian charm at this luxurious resort complex, featuring traditional architecture and stunning views.
  10. Global Village: Experience a world of cultural exhibits, shopping, entertainment, and a wide array of international cuisine.

Getting around Dubai is a seamless experience, boasting a well-connected transportation system encompassing an advanced metro, buses, and water taxis, providing both locals and visitors with efficient options for exploring the city. Additionally, the abundance of taxis offers a convenient and accessible way to effortlessly traverse Dubai's dynamic landscapes and discover its rich blend of modern attractions and cultural gems.
